Abstract
The utility model relates to electromagnetism winding technique fields, it is intended to provide a kind of magnet ring coiling tooling convenient for adjusting height, its key points of the technical solution are that including bottom plate and the positioning component for positioning magnet ring, the bottom plate includes fixing plate and moving plate, the positioning component is arranged on movable plate, and the lift component for changing distance between fixing plate and moving plate is equipped between the fixing plate and moving plate;This magnet ring coiling convenient for adjusting height can be adjusted its height according to the use demand of itself with tooling convenient for staff, to meet the use demand of different operating personnel.

Background technique
Magnet ring is one piece of cricoid magnetizer.Magnet ring is common anti-interference element in electronic circuit, for high-frequency noise
There is good inhibiting effect.
Notification number is that the Chinese patent of CN205354859U discloses a kind of magnet ring wire winding tool, the magnet ring wire winding tool
Pressing plate and several tweezers including bottom plate, on bottom plate;The tweezers include first clamping piece and connected to it
Two intermediate plates, the first clamping piece is transversely arranged and is fixedly mounted on the top of bottom plate, and the bottom plate is located at the left and right of first clamping piece
Both ends are provided with the kidney slot of a longitudinal direction, and the pressing plate is located at the top of second intermediate plate, and both ends are provided with a cunning
Lever, the sliding bar are plugged in kidney slot and can move along the track of kidney slot.
This tooling is all located on workbench when in use, and the height of workbench is unadjustable, but is different work
It is different to make height requirement locating when personnel use tooling, and the height of above-mentioned tooling is also unadjustable, accordingly, it is difficult to full
The use demand of sufficient different operating personnel.
